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
Componentes DNS
DNS se compone de un espacio de nombres, que puede definirse como
el conjunto de hosts conocidos por DNS (podramos decir que son
todos los hosts que integran Internet). El espacio de nombres puede
representarse como una estructura de rbol, jerrquica
DNS es una gran base de datos distribuida y en principio el objetivo es
resolver a partir de un nombre de host perteneciente a un dominio una
direccin IP; pero no es el nico objetivo de DNS, tambin lo es
realizar la operacin inversa, es decir a partir de una direccin IP
resolver un nombre de host. Para esto se crea otro espacio de nombres
DNS, formados por dominios pero en donde cada etiqueta del rbol es
una parte de la direccin IP.
Directorio
Un directorio es una base de datos optimizada para
lectura, navegacin y bsqueda. Los directorios tienden
a contener informacin descriptiva basada en atributos
y tienen capacidades de filtrado muy sofisticada. Los
directorios generalmente no soportan transacciones
complicadas ni esquemas de vuelta atrs como los que
se encuentran en los sistemas de bases de datos
diseados para manejar grandes y complejos
volmenes de actualizaciones. Las actualizaciones de
los directorios son normalmente cambios simples, o
todo o nada, siempre y cuando estn permitidos. Los
directorios estn afinados para dar una rpida
respuesta a grandes volmenes de bsquedas.
Directorio
Tpicamente, un servicio global define
un espacio de nombres uniforme que
da la misma visin de los datos,
independientemente de donde se
estn, en relacin a los propios datos.
El servicio DNS (Domain Name
System) es un ejemplo de un sistema
de directorio globalmente distribuido.
root
com
att
aus
edu
sun
corp
mit
eng
gov
ucb
uk
mil
jp
ddn
ntt
nic
tokyo
in-addr.arpa.
...
...
1
2
.
.
.
254
...
128
50
...
...
255
255
255
CONFIGURACIN
Copiar los archivos desde
/usr/share/doc/bind-(version)/sample
En: /var/named/chroot
zone "linux.edu.uy" IN {
type master;
file "linux.zone";
};
zone "142.20.20.in-addr.arpa" IN {
type master;
file "linux.rev";
};
};
# incluir la referencia al archivo con las zonas
include "/etc/named.rfc1912.zones";
Modificacin en el Master
zone "linux.edu.uy" IN {
type master;
allow-transfer {20.20.142.102; };
file "linux.zone";
};
zone "142.20.20.in-addr.arpa" IN {
type master;
allow-transfer {20.20.142.102; };
file "linux.rev";
};
Configuracin
Modificacin en Slave
zone "linux.edu.uy" IN {
type slave;
masters { 20.20.142.104; };
file "named.zone";
};
zone "142.20.20.in-addr.arpa" IN {
type slave;
masters { 20.20.142.104; };
file "linux.rev";
};
RNDC